E-check payments to double in 2003

The number of e-check payments is due to reach the one billion mark in 2003, according to research from the Electronic Payments Association (NACHA).This would double the figures seen in 2002.

The popularity of e-check payments in Europe differs vastly to the US. While it is largely accepted in the former, there is a reluctance to move away from the traditional form of paper check payments in the latter. As well as efficiency gains, electronic payments help fight fraud.
